Default Cd Feature Left Off Some Blu-ray Players Is A Minor Feature

The Samsung, Philips, Panasonic, and Sony Playstation 3 Blu-ray players play CD’s. The Pioneer BDP-HD1 and Sony BDP-S1 are great players with 1080P/24 support but they don’t play CD’s. Most likely second generation Pioneer and Sony machines will play CD’s. Sony and Pioneer wanted to get these first generation high quality players to market as soon as possible and they most likely felt the CD feature being left off is a miner feature. Possible with a firmware update the CD feature could be added.
If I owned a display that accept 1080P/24 I would buy the Pioneer Blu-ray and to me the CD feature is a minor issue. People that own a basic 1080P set with out 24 fps input would enjoy the Sony Playstation 3. For the average user the Playstation 3 is the way to go.
